Repairing Particle Board With Wood Filler
- 1). Scrape out the broken area, using an awl to remove loose particles. Don't dig too hard; particle board will fall apart if excessive pressure is used.
- 2). Mix the wood putty according to instructions on the box.
- 3). Apply the wood filler into the particle board using the applicator bottle that came with the putty.
- 4). Allow the putty to dry for 20 to 30 minutes.
- 5). Cover the patch with masking tapes on all side to protect the good wood. Sand the wood putty smooth and flush with the rest of the wood. Paint the wood putty the same color as the rest of the particle board.
